In depth

Verdict

Halfwaytoparadise, Sion Hill and Mis Chicaf look the three to concentrate on in this awful opener and the vote goes to Halfwaytoparadise. Consistency is not the strong suit of any of these really, but Bill Turner's filly is about as good as it gets in this field in that respect. Recent form has seen her in the frame at Lingfield over a mile and at Brighton over 7f, and then finally breaking her maiden tag in a Brighton claimer a couple of weeks ago. Perhaps that success will be enough of a confidence boost for see her follow up and a repeat effort would probably see her score. Miss Chicaf has not won since her three-year-old days and never beyond 6f, but she did put in a decent effort in context when third at Ayr last time. A similar performance would probably see her make the frame but she is not one to trust and we will oppose. Sion Hill took a 9f Wolverhampton claimer last time out and is clearly in good nick, and perhaps, like the selection, that first win will be enough to give him the confidence to follow up. However, this trip may be on the short side for him and so we will take him on. Little else appeals and Halfwaytoparadise gets the nod.
